Webtip-off (n.) 1901 in reference to information, from tip (v.2) + off (adv.). From 1924 in basketball, from tip (v.3). Entries linking to tip-off tip (v.2) "give a small present of money to," c. 1600, originally "to give, hand, pass," thieves' cant, perhaps from tip (v.3) "to tap." The meaning "give a gratuity to" is first attested 1706. Webtip off v. 1.
